GoJS

 
 

Diagramok létrehozása és manipulálása JavaScript API-n keresztül

Nyílt forráskódú JavaScript-könyvtár, amely lehetővé teszi a fejlesztők számára diagramok, diagramok és grafikonok létrehozását és feldolgozását saját JavaScript-alkalmazásaikon belül.

Egy nagyon hatékony JavaScript-könyvtár, amely lehetővé teszi a szoftverfejlesztők számára, hogy diagramokat, diagramokat és grafikonokat generáljanak és kezeljenek saját JavaScript-alkalmazásaikon belül. A könyvtár támogatja a beépített elrendezéseket, például a faelrendezést, a radiális, valamint a réteges digráf-elrendezést és néhány egyéni elrendezést. A könyvtár könnyen használható webböngészőben vagy szerveroldali Node vagy Puppeteer alkalmazásban.

A GoJS könyvtár nagyon rugalmas, és lehetővé teszi a fejlesztők számára, hogy számos különböző típusú diagramot készítsenek, például folyamatábrákat, orvosi diagramokat, szervezeti diagramokat, tervezőeszközöket, tervezési eszközöket, állapotdiagramokat, Sankey-diagramokat, ipari folyamatokat, vizuális nyelveket stb. .

A könyvtár nagyon hatékony interaktív funkciókat kínál, mint például diagram elemeinek húzása, tartalom másolása és beillesztése, eszköztippek, helyi menük, sablonok használata, adatkötési támogatás, eseménykezelők, automatikus elrendezések, testreszabható animációk alkalmazása és még sok más. A HTML Canvas elemet renderelheti és exportálhatja SVG-be, valamint más képformátumokba.

Previous Next

A GoJS használatának első lépései

A GoJS telepítésének javasolt módja az npm, amely az npm csomagkezelőn keresztül érhető el, használja a következő parancsokat.

Telepítse a GoJS-t npm-en keresztül

$ npm install gojs --save

Folyamatábrák rajzolása JavaScript API-n keresztül

A nyílt forráskódú GoJS-könyvtár számos diagramtípus létrehozásához, valamint speciális funkciók és elrendezések bemutatásához nyújtott támogatást. Néhány soros JavaScript kóddal folyamatábrákat rajzolhat. A könyvtár támogatja a palettákat, a linkelhető csomópontokat, a húzás/dobás viselkedést, a szövegszerkesztést, valamint a csomóponti sablonleképezések használatát folyamatábra diagramok rajzolásához. A meglévő diagramot és diagramcsomópontot, valamint a Textblockot is könnyedén módosíthatja.

Állapotdiagram létrehozása és szerkesztése JavaScript segítségével

Az állapotdiagram a rendszerek viselkedésének leírására szolgál. Az állapotdiagram segítségével a rendszer vagy a rendszer egy részének állapota véges számú állapotban vagy időpontban ábrázolható. A GoJS könyvtár támogatást nyújtott az állapotdiagramok egyszerű létrehozásához és szerkesztéséhez. Könnyedén rajzolhat annyi csomópontot, amennyit csak akar, és annyi hivatkozást rajzolhat egyik csomópontról a másikra, amennyit kíván, és átformálhatja a hivatkozásokat, vagy eltávolíthatja őket, ha kiválasztják.

Logikai áramkör generálása JavaScript segítségével

A logikai kapuk minden digitális rendszer alapvető építőkövei. A logikai kapu ideális számítási modell vagy logikai függvényt megvalósító fizikai elektronikus eszköz. A könyvtár nagyon gazdag funkciókban, és számos fontos funkciót biztosított a kapuk és vezetékek segítségével történő áramkörök kialakításához. Nagyon felhasználóbarát, és segít a felhasználóknak a diagramok egyszerű kezelésében. A paletta lehetővé teszi új csomópontok áthúzását és a diagram kezelését. Könnyen frissítheti az egyes csomópontokat típus szerint, amely a csomópontba mutató hivatkozások színét használja a csomópontból kilépők színének meghatározásához.

Rajzolj és helyezd el a diagramelemeket

A nyílt forráskódú GoJS könyvtár lehetővé teszi a szoftverfejlesztők számára, hogy könnyedén megrajzolják és elhelyezzék a diagramelemeket saját JavaScript-alkalmazásaikon belül. A könyvtár lehetővé teszi a fejlesztők számára, hogy kiválasszák és egymáshoz képest pozícionálják a diagram kiválasztott részeit, mindössze néhány sornyi kóddal. Könnyen kezelheti a nyílbillentyűket is, és "beillesztési eltolást" is használhat, így az objektumok beillesztése egymásra helyezi őket, nem pedig egymásra helyezi őket.

 Magyar